OpenCloudOS 和 Debian 是两种不同的 Linux 发行版,各自面向不同的使用场景和目标用户。以下是它们之间的比较,从多个维度进行分析:
1. 背景与发起方
| 项目 | OpenCloudOS | Debian |
|---|---|---|
| 发起方 | 腾讯主导,联合多家企业(如中国移动、中兴、深信服等)共同发起的开源社区项目 | 由全球志愿者组成的非营利性社区项目,始于1993年 |
| 社区性质 | 中国企业主导的开源社区,聚焦云原生和服务器场景 | 全球性、去中心化的自由软件社区 |
| 开源协议 | 开放源码,强调企业级支持与云环境适配 | 完全自由开源,严格遵循自由软件理念 |
2. 定位与目标场景
| 项目 | OpenCloudOS | Debian |
|---|---|---|
| 主要用途 | 面向云计算、数据中心、容器化、微服务等企业级场景 | 通用型发行版,适用于服务器、桌面、嵌入式等多种场景 |
| 目标用户 | 企业用户、云服务商、开发者(尤其是国内企业) | 广大开发者、个人用户、科研机构、中小企业 |
| 特点 | 强调稳定性、安全性、长期支持(LTS),适合生产环境 | 极高的稳定性和广泛的软件支持,被誉为“最稳定的发行版”之一 |
3. 系统架构与包管理
| 项目 | OpenCloudOS | Debian |
|---|---|---|
| 基础来源 | 最初基于 CentOS/Fedora 生态发展,现为独立研发的 Linux 发行版(部分版本兼容 RHEL 生态) | 独立开发,不基于其他发行版 |
| 包管理系统 | 使用 yum/dnf + RPM 包格式(类 Red Hat 体系) |
使用 apt + .deb 包格式(Debian 体系) |
| 软件仓库 | 企业优化软件源,侧重云原生工具链(如 Kubernetes、Docker、Prometheus 等) | 全球最大的自由软件仓库之一,软件包极其丰富 |
⚠️ 注意:早期 OpenCloudOS 可能与 RHEL/CentOS 兼容,但新版本正逐步走向独立。
4. 稳定性与更新策略
| 项目 | OpenCloudOS | Debian |
|---|---|---|
| 发布模式 | 长期支持版本(LTS),每几年发布一个大版本,持续维护 | 分为三个分支: • Stable(稳定) • Testing(测试) • Unstable(不稳定) Stable 版本非常可靠 |
| 更新频率 | 较低,注重企业环境稳定性 | Stable 版本更新慢,但极其稳定;Testing/Unstable 更新快 |
| 安全更新 | 提供企业级安全补丁和快速响应机制 | 社区维护安全更新,响应迅速且透明 |
5. 生态与兼容性
| 项目 | OpenCloudOS | Debian |
|---|---|---|
| 国内支持 | 对中文环境、国产硬件(如鲲鹏、飞腾)、中间件有良好适配 | 支持广泛,但对国产软硬件需额外配置 |
| 国际生态 | 正在建设中,主要覆盖国内及亚洲市场 | 全球影响力巨大,绝大多数开源项目优先支持 Debian/Ubuntu |
| 云平台集成 | 深度集成腾讯云等国内云平台,支持一键部署 | AWS、Google Cloud、Azure 等国际云厂商官方支持 Debian |
6. 技术支持与文档
| 项目 | OpenCloudOS | Debian |
|---|---|---|
| 技术支持 | 提供企业级商业支持(通过合作厂商),社区支持逐步完善 | 主要依赖社区支持,文档详尽,社区活跃 |
| 文档质量 | 中文文档较完善,适合国内用户 | 英文文档极佳,中文资料也较丰富 |
7. 典型应用场景对比
| 场景 | 推荐系统 |
|---|---|
| 国内企业私有云/混合云部署 | ✅ OpenCloudOS(本地化支持好) |
| 国际化部署或公有云环境 | ✅ Debian(兼容性强) |
| 高稳定性服务器(如数据库、Web 服务) | ✅ Debian Stable |
| 容器/Kubernetes 平台底层 OS | ✅ OpenCloudOS(优化更好)或 Debian |
| 学习/开发/个人使用 | ✅ Debian(软件多,社区大) |
总结:选择建议
| 如果你… | 推荐系统 |
|---|---|
| 在中国运营企业级云平台,需要本土化支持 | 🔄 OpenCloudOS |
| 追求极致稳定性和自由软件理念 | 🔄 Debian |
| 使用腾讯云或其他国内云服务 | 🔄 OpenCloudOS 更优集成 |
| 需要大量第三方软件包或国际化生态 | 🔄 Debian 更成熟 |
| 希望获得商业支持和技术保障 | 🔄 OpenCloudOS(有厂商支持) |
| 偏好 APT 包管理和 DEB 生态 | 🔄 Debian |
补充说明
- OpenCloudOS 是近年来中国推动“自主可控”操作系统生态的重要成果之一,类似于华为的 OpenEuler、阿里的 Anolis OS。
- Debian 是许多流行发行版(如 Ubuntu、Linux Mint)的基础,生态系统极为成熟。
✅ 结论:
如果你在构建国内企业级云基础设施,追求深度本地化支持和长期稳定维护,OpenCloudOS 是一个值得考虑的选择。
如果你更看重全球生态、软件丰富度和自由软件原则,Debian 依然是黄金标准。
两者并非完全竞争关系,而是互补于不同生态位。
ECLOUD博客